When reviewing tax returns, it was necessary to go through each parcel one by one, compare the cadastral records, title deeds, land blocks, and other supporting documents, and then manually verify where a change or discrepancy had occurred. The problem was not only the time required, but also the verifiability and completeness of the documentation, particularly regarding discrepancies between land ownership and actual land use.
Šarišské Sokolovce is already working with map data on mapsfy.com, and it was important for them to have tax data, parcels, and land use information all in one place so they wouldn’t have to piece together information from multiple sources.
